    1979 was the peak year for post-punk. Picking up the torch from the already stale and fast dying punk scene, adopting its spirit but injecting it with a new sense of invention, artistry and a range of eclectic influences in place of punk’s self inflicted limitations, there were genre defining debuts from Joy Division and Gang Of Four, as well as classic follow ups from the likes of Wire and Public Image Ltd among many others.
